Types of AC Motor Controllers

AC motor controllers can be categorized based on their operational characteristics and applications. The following table outlines the different types of AC motor controllers available in the market.

Type Description Applications
Single Phase Controllers Designed for single-phase AC motors, suitable for light-duty applications. Household appliances, small machines.
Three Phase Controllers Used for three-phase AC motors, providing higher power and efficiency. Industrial machinery, HVAC systems.
Variable Frequency Drives Allows for precise speed control by varying the frequency of the input power. Conveyor systems, pumps, fans.
Soft Starters Reduces inrush current during motor startup, protecting the motor. Pumps, compressors, fans.
Servo Controllers Provides high precision control for servo motors, often used in robotics. Robotics, CNC machines.

Insights into AC Motor Controllers

AC motor controllers are integral to the operation of electric motors, providing essential functionalities that enhance performance and efficiency. They convert incoming AC power to DC and then back to AC at the desired frequency, allowing for precise control over motor speed and torque. This process is crucial for applications requiring variable speed and direction.

Key Benefits

  1. Energy Efficiency: Modern AC motor controllers optimize energy consumption, reducing operational costs.
  2. Enhanced Control: They offer advanced control features, including speed regulation and torque management.
  3. Protection Mechanisms: Built-in protections against overloads and electrical faults ensure motor longevity and reliability.
